subcelestial

American  
[suhb-suh-les-chuhl] / ˌsʌb səˈlɛs tʃəl /

adjective

  1. being beneath the heavens; terrestrial.

  2. mundane; worldly.


noun

  1. a subcelestial being.

Etymology

Origin of subcelestial

First recorded in 1555–65; sub- + celestial
